Lifetimes in neutron-rich mass 100 nuclei measured by a doppler profile method

The Eurogam-1 array has been used to study γ rays emitted following the spontaneous fission of a 248Cm source. The stopping of the fission fragments in the source material leads to Doppler-broadened γ-ray lineshapes for those states that have lifetime comparable to the stopping time. From the analysis of these lineshapes the transition quadrupole moments for the Yrast states in the neutron-rich nuclei 100,102Zr and 104,106Mo in the spin range 6-12 ℎ have been deduced.
